Détails de la leçon
Description de la leçon
Dans cette leçon, nous allons examiner comment utiliser les fonctions Excel au sein d'une macro VBA pour déterminer si un nombre est pair ou impair. Plutôt que d'utiliser l'opérateur modulo, nous explorerons comment exploiter les fonctions Excel EST.PAIR et EST.IMPAIR directement dans Visual Basic. Cette méthode implique la manipulation de l'objet Application et de la collection WorksheetFunction, permettant ainsi d'appeler les fonctions d'Excel depuis VBA.
Nous verrons également comment nommer correctement nos sous-routines et éviter les conflits de noms, ainsi que des astuces pour découvrir les noms anglais des fonctions Excel si votre interface est en français. À travers cet exemple de zonage de lignes, vous apprendrez à colorier conditionnellement les cellules en utilisant la fonction Application.WorksheetFunction.IsOdd
dans une boucle, tout en assurant la performance et la clarté de votre code.
Objectifs de cette leçon
Les objectifs incluent l'apprentissage de l'intégration des fonctions Excel dans VBA, la manipulation conditionnelle des données, et l'amélioration de l'efficacité du code.
Prérequis pour cette leçon
Connaissances de base en programmation VBA et en utilisation d'Excel.
Métiers concernés
Automatisation des processus dans les métiers de l'analyse de données, la finance, et la gestion de projet.
Alternatives et ressources
Utilisation de l'opérateur modulo ou autres langages de programmation pour des tâches similaires.
Questions & Réponses
Application.WorksheetFunction
.